Captain Wilson had a phenomenal day on January 23 with Martin Wicks’ group. They had simultaneous Sailfish releases:





Safe released as always. For the icebox they added tasty Yellowfin Tuna.



The Wanderer struck hard again on January 23 with a wonderful Blue Marlin battle:




This bad boy broke the leader for the release. Later on they scored this super Sailfish release.

The Wanderer delivered dinner with this monster Yellowfin Tuna.





The Adventurer had a fun time on January 23 with this funky little Yellowfin Tuna catch.

Ruben Hinojosa and Vicki Chrysler fought a monster Marlin with the Discoverer on January 22.


Sailfish releases also dot the scorecard.


They also scored a 200+lbs. Yellowfin Tuna



The Explorer kept up the hot action on January 21st with multiple Sailfish releases backed-up with tasty Yellowfin Tunas.







On January 20 the Explorer scored a nice pile of Yellowfin Tunas.




The Harvester worked offshore on January 19 with FishingNosara Hall of Famer Martin Wicks scoring big billfish.


A big Black Marlin release was augmented by several super Sailfish.







For the dinner table they scored this BIG Yellowfin Tuna:


The Harvester scored on January 16 with a fabulous Blue Marlin release.




They also brought home this BIG Yellowfin Tuna.

Master Captain William and the mighty flagship Wanderer stayed on the bite in mid-January with these amazing blue water scores:










These Marlin releases were augmented with big Dorados and Yellowfin Tunas for the dinner table:



The Harvester delivered exquisite Yellowfin Tunas on January 15.
